Benjamin Raspail

Benjamin Raspail (1823 - 1899), French painter, engraver, politician and monoped, son of Major Francois-Vincent Raspail (1794-1878). As member of the conseil for Seine for the republican left, Raspail proposed the law, on 21 May 1880, which made 14 July a French national holiday in commemoration of the storming of the Bastille
